Abstract
This chapter examines the potential of metaverse technology to transform the banking industry and promote financial inclusion. It provides an overview of the historical development of metaverse and its potential impact on the banking industry while identifying key opportunities to improve access to financial services, financial education, and customer engagement, as well as potential risks such as exacerbating inequalities and privacy concerns. The chapter also considers the ethical and societal implications of metaverse technology, emphasizing the importance of corporate social responsibility and stakeholder theory for responsible implementation. In conclusion, this chapter offers a comprehensive analysis of the opportunities and risks of metaverse technology for financial inclusion in the banking industry and highlights the need for responsible development and governance as well as stakeholder participation.
